What Is a Casino Online?

casino online

A casino online is an Internet-based gambling establishment that offers players the chance to play a variety of casino games using real money. These sites can be accessed by PCs, tablets and mobile devices. Almost all casino games that can be played in a traditional land-based casino can also be found online. These websites are usually licensed and regulated, which means that they must adhere to strict rules in order to maintain their license. In addition, they must provide their players with safe and secure transactions.

The best way to find an online casino is by reading reviews from trusted websites. These reviews will help you determine which casinos are reputable and which ones you should avoid. However, keep in mind that some reviews may be biased and have been written for marketing purposes. Nevertheless, you should try to read as many as possible in order to make the most informed decision.

You can find a number of different kinds of casino games on the Internet, including video poker, blackjack and roulette. The most popular casino game, however, is online slots, which don’t require any strategy or previous knowledge to play. To start playing, you need a functioning device that can access the Internet, as well as money for wagers and bets. Moreover, you need to sign up for an account at the casino online and make a deposit using your preferred banking method.

Another way to control your gambling spending is to set deposit limits. This will prevent you from depositing too much money at once and putting yourself in a financial crisis. You can also take advantage of reality checks that most online casinos offer. These tools will tell you how long you have spent on the site and can be helpful in avoiding impulse decisions. It is also important not to chase losses. This is one of the biggest mistakes that many casino online players make and can quickly deplete your bankroll. You can also use timeouts to lock yourself out of the website for a while, which will help you stay on track and not lose too much.
